Apache (the Apache HTTP Server) is a good fit for people who want a stable, widely supported, open-source web server—especially for small to medium sites, shared hosting, PHP-based sites, or environments that value flexibility and lots of modules. It’s also a solid choice if you need something well-known and easy to find documentation for.
You may want to avoid Apache if you need extremely high performance at very large scale with minimal resource use, or if your setup is better suited to an event-driven server like Nginx or a more modern stack. It can also be less ideal if you want the simplest possible configuration for a high-traffic reverse proxy setup.

Apache HTTP Server is one of the most established web servers, and its main strengths are flexibility, broad module support, and long-standing compatibility. Compared with Nginx, Apache is usually easier to extend and configure for traditional .htaccess-based hosting, while Nginx is typically faster and more efficient under high concurrency. Compared with Microsoft IIS, Apache is more platform-neutral and open-source, while IIS fits best in Windows-centric environments. Compared with LiteSpeed, Apache is less performant out of the box, but it is free, widely supported, and very mature. In short: Apache is best for compatibility and flexibility; Nginx often wins on speed; IIS on Windows integration; LiteSpeed on raw performance.

If you mean the Apache HTTP Server, its main competitors are Nginx and Microsoft IIS. Apache is known for flexibility, broad module support, and a long track record, which makes it a strong choice for compatibility and customization. Compared with Nginx, Apache is usually less efficient at handling very high concurrency, while Nginx is often faster and lighter for static content and reverse proxying. Compared with IIS, Apache is cross-platform and more common in open-source/Linux environments, while IIS fits best in Microsoft ecosystems. Overall, Apache is a solid, mature, and versatile server, but it is often chosen more for compatibility and features than for raw performance.

For most startups, the cheapest API testing tool is Bruno — it’s free, local-first, and open source.
If you want, I can also give you the cheapest option for team collaboration vs the cheapest option for CI automation.
Cheapest: Bruno — $0 for the open-source plan. It’s local-first and Git-native, so it’s a strong startup choice if you want to avoid SaaS lock-in. (usebruno.com)
Also free: Insomnia Essentials ($0/user/month) and Postman Free ($0). (insomnia.rest)
My pick for startups: Bruno if you want the lowest cost and code/Git workflow; Postman if you want the most familiar team platform; Insomnia if you want a free polished client with some collaboration built in. (usebruno.com)
